Young Film Fund (UK)
First Light Movies provides grants to projects that enable young people
to participate in all aspects of film productions. Since launching in
2001, First Light Movies have enabled over 12,000 young filmmakers to
write, act, shoot, light, direct and produce over 800 films. The funding
is available to organisations such as schools, youth services, community
and voluntary groups that work with young people aged between 5 and 18.
Every year approximately £700,000 of grants is available through three
funding streams. The Studio Awards provides grants of up to £30, 000 for
between two and four films of up to 10 minutes. The Script Awards
provides grants of up to £3,000 for script writing projects that team
young people with script professionals. The Pilot Awards provides grants
of up to £5,000 for one short film of up to five minutes in duration.
The Script and Pilot elements of the fund will re-open for applications
on the 2nd March and closes for applications on the 27th April 2010. For
